while looking at how BBB takes care of old recordings I realized that the cronjob script does not delete data in /var/bigbluebutton/recording/raw where I still find all the individual webcam streams. The data that seems to be necessary for playback is in /var/bigbluebutton/publish

So can I simply delete the data from  /var/bigbluebutton/recording/raw  without BBB getting upset about missing data?

Why are the raw recordings kept from being deleted by the cronjob after the usual 5 days?

Hi Oliver,

The raw directory contains the archive of the 'raw' events and media from the recording.  By retaining its contents, the administrator of a BigBlueButton server can regenerate the playback files from source files at any time.

We provide the command

  sudo bbb-record --rebuildall

to do this.  We did this many times during the development of 0.81 as we fixed and updated the record and playback scripts.  

> So can I simply delete the data from  /var/bigbluebutton/recording/raw  without BBB getting upset about missing data?

Yes, you could delete it on the same schedule as the other files.  

However, you may want to keep them for one (or more) of the following reasons:

  1. The record and playback scripts got stuck on processing particular recording and you didn't notice it for may days.  In this case other unprocessed recordings would start to become deleted (unlikely as we tested these scripts with thousands of recordings, but still possible)
  2. There is a recording that does not process a recording correctly and you want to reprocess it
  3. We update the record and playback scripts in 0.81 (unlikely as we're pretty focused in 0.9.0)

Hi Navid,

Can you edit 

  /etc/cron.daily/bigbluebutton

and change the value of unrecorded_days to 1, see


This will remove RAW data for recordings that have no start/stop recording marks.  For recordings that have been properly published, you can change the value of published_days to 1 as well (or some number lower than 14).

Try the above and let us know if you still have files remaining after a few days.
